Job Description

Job Description

Duties:

  • Manages all aspects of project planning and development in programs, including: Engineering and Construction; Technical Support; Bidding Strategy; Schedules; Budget; Funding source and allocations; Grants Management; Prioritization of Work; and Finalization and Closeout.
  • Reviews, analyzes, and interprets complex project design and construction budgets, schedules, and costs to ensure conformance with authorized scope, time and dollar requirements.
  • Supervises project planners in developing projects’ scope, schedule, and budget making sure that the goals and vision of the stakeholders are reflected.
  • Develops funding strategies for each of the projects within a program, including leveraging funds with state match grants, private grants, and identifying non-profit partners, etc.
  • Resolves or reduces cost overruns by performing value engineering.
  • Reviews project data and develops executive reports for stakeholders and proposes new projects in specific programs as required.
  • Manages the financial closeout of programs by ensuring project documents are finalized and financial reports have been reviewed and in accordance with the guidelines of the funding sources, following substantial completion.
  • Acts as liaison and provides necessary documentation for closed-out projects under litigation and participates in depositions whenever necessary.
  • Reviews and assesses program strengths and limitations and makes recommendations for areas requiring improvement, including program reporting and process.
  • Resolves technically complex issues for architects, engineers, and/or other lower-level project managers.
  • Coordinates the formulation of policies and procedures related to Construction Programs, including the development of funding policies, requests for appropriation, and alterations and improvements of new programs.
  • Coordinates and recommends updates to construction specification guidelines.
  • Engages in community and stakeholder meetings regarding high profile projects, summarizes meeting agenda and prepares reports related to project progress for distribution.
  • Participates in job meetings and job walks and reviews project documentation to ensure compliance with program requirements.
  • Maintains lessons learned in all programs and participates in providing trainings to staff for program and project improvements.
  • Mediates conflicts between project staff with regards to scope, materials and other requirements and offers solutions; assists with dispute mediation between various project staff.
  • Participates in change order negotiations and assists with contract review process.

Minimum Requirements
Required Experience:

  • Ten (10) years full time paid professional experience in the management and administration of various programs and projects under programs to include, scope development, planning and design, budget and funding allocation and close-out.
  • Minimum four (4) years’ experience in managing programs in a public or educational agency, with full responsibility for coordinating complex activities.
  • Experience in managing multiple education or public agency programs concurrently is preferred

Required Education:

  • Graduation from a recognized college or university with a bachelor’s degree, preferably in Architecture, Engineering or Construction Management.
  • Candidates who do not meet the education requirements may substitute experience on a year for year basis.

Preferred Licenses and Certificates:

  • A valid Certificate of Registration as an Architect by the California State Architectural Board or Professional Engineer by the State Board for Professional Engineers and Land Surveyors
  • A valid Construction Manager (CCM) credential by the Construction Manager Certification Institute (CMCI)
  • LEED Professional Accreditation
